    The Acer Predator Helios Neo 16 AI (PHN16-73) arrives as a compelling contender in the high-performance gaming laptop space, aiming to strike that elusive sweet spot between raw power, a premium feel, and a manageable form factor. On paper, it's a winner, centered around a spectacular 240Hz OLED display that promises a top-tier visual experience. However, this machine is a true paradox. As we discovered, its greatest strength, that beautiful screen, is also the source of its most significant and frustrating flaws.     Pros

    • Stunning 240Hz OLED display with 100% DCI-P3 coverage
    • Excellent and stable gaming performance
    • Fantastic upgradeability with two RAM and two M.2 slots
    • Great port selection, including a Thunderbolt 4 port
    • Comfortable keyboard with full-sized arrow keys and a NumPad
    • Premium-feeling and chic design

    Cons

    • Extremely reflective glossy screen, one of the worst measured + PWM for brightness control, bad for eye-safety
    • Mediocre battery life for a 90Wh capacity
    • No physical privacy shutter for the webcam

    Disassembly, maintenance and upgrade options

    Opening the device Hint: Use a Torx T6 screwdriver and a plastic pry tool to avoid scratching the chassis.Remove the ten Torx T6 screws from the bottom panel. Release the clips around the perimeter using a plastic tool. Lift the panel away to expose the internals.Battery removal Caution: The 90 Wh battery has exposed cells—handle carefully to avoid puncturing.Locate the four-cell 90 Wh battery pack in the lower section.
